Port Kembla Copper Stack Demolition

Port Kembla is a heavy industry centre south of Sydney. Copper smelting was the first heavy industry established in the city dating back to 1908.
The 'Stack' was a regional landmark that was erected in 1965 and stood 198 metres tall. The Stack was demolished on 20 February 2014. The plant had closed in 2008.
